The Piper baseball team received two solid pitching performances in a MIAC doubleheader against Gustavus Adolphus at CHS Field. Unfortunately, they ran into very good Gustie pitching efforts and dropped a pair of 3-0 games.
In the opener,
Nolan Schoonveld scattered eight hits over 5.2 innings but was victimized when the only two batters he walked eventually scored runs.
Devin Rodgers had two of Hamline's four hits with
Cullen Buck and
Cyle Hartwig garnering the others.
In the nightcap, four pitchers held GAC to five hits. Hamline, however, could only muster two first inning runners on an error and a walk and an
Eric Erb second sinning single off GAC pitcher Charlie Hutchinson.
The Pipers are now 13-18 overall, 5-9 in MIAC play. Hamline hosts Crown Thursday at CHS in a nine-inning non-conference affair that commences at 5:00 p.m.
